I love Sixpence but to my palate it is not quite the same as Silver Flake. The spicy factor in Sixpence is more perique based, whereas the spicy in SF is from the rich dark-fried Kentucky. SF is a fantastic blend with a lame packaging design. That acknowledged, it is still very much worth the effort to jar it for the long term. YMMV...

I'm shocked the manufacturer didn't seal the bags better than they do with these.... It's just folded over, and anything but secure for anything but short term storage. Crazy. At the very least they could have used a ziplock bag..

I jar mine right away.

With anything from Solani, I buy the 50g tins where the option exists; which goes against my buying preferences where I always buy 100g tins
